The College of Optometrists is the professional body for optometry. It qualifies the profession and delivers the guidance and development to ensure optometrists provide the best possible care. We promote excellence through the College’s affixes, by building the evidence base for optometry, and raising awareness of the profession with the public, commissioners, and healthcare professionals.

Acuity is the quarterly College journal, delivered in print to around 15,000 College members, and with views to Acuity digital articles at almost 70,000 per annum. A highly regarded journal within the profession, the articles range from clinical information, highlighting best practice, drawing attention to specific issues or conditions, inspirational stories from members and patients, and College news.
